Didn’t get quite as far as I hoped today, but I got a late start and had a lot of distractions. Started off the day with 6 or 7 random charges on our checking account so obviously that was a priority over the truck. lol After that I was able to slowly ramp up into full speed for a few hours.

To start with... I had to build a brace/crossmember for the top of the frame between the shackle hangers. I spaced this off until today but it was pretty simple. Took a piece of 1x2 and some big allen head bolts that may or may not have ended up in my lunch box when I worked at the mine. Should work....
